Mulrine, Erna

Erna R. Mulrine, age 94, of Newark, Delaware, passed away February 3, 2026.

Erna graduated from Olney High School in 1949 before spending a year at Pierce Business School. She began working as a part-time PBX operator and receptionist at Kitson while attending Pierce. After Kitson she worked as a stewardess for TWA, then Pan American Airlines in the same role. After her airline career, she worked for McArdle Clooney Plumbing as a PBX operator and receptionist. Over the course of her career, Erna held several receptionist positions, including work at Standard Chlorine in Delaware City and later for several law firms in Wilmington.

During the years 1953 to 1955, Erna traveled by ship (SS United States) several times to Germany to visit her mother’s and father’s family. Between 1961 and 1962, Erna met her future husband, Vincent, through her work at McArdle Clooney while Vince was ordering plumbing supplies. They began dating and were married on August 1, 1964.

Erna was an active member of the Delaware Saengerbund Club in Newark, a member of Eastern Star Chapter #10 in Newark, and a member of St. Paul’s Lutheran Church in Newark. Her interests included sewing, cooking, and baking. She enjoyed watching her grandchildren and was an avid sports fan, particularly of the Phillies and the Eagles. She also enjoyed music by Mario Lanza, Helmut Lotti, Andrea Bocelli, and Elvis Presley.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Vincent H. Mulrine (George); her father, Hugo Roessle; her mother, Clara Roessle; and her brother, Erwin Roessle.

She is survived by her son, Vincent L. Mulrine; her grandchildren, Nikolas Mulrine, Sydney Mulrine, and Alex Brown (step-grandchild). She is also survived by several cousins, close friends, neighbors, and extended family, including family in Germany.
